Abstract Purpose To describe symptoms and side effects experienced by patients with advanced non-small cell lung cancer (NSCLC), assess how patients allocate sensations (i.e. symptoms or side effects) to either the disease or its treatment, and evaluate how patients balance side effects with treatment benefits. Methods Qualitative sub-studies were conducted as part of two clinical trials in patients treated for advanced NSCLC (AURA [NCT01802632]; ARCTIC [NCT02352948]). Results Interviews were conducted with 23 patients and 19 patients in the AURA and ARCTIC sub-studies, respectively. The most commonly experienced symptoms/side effects were respiratory (81% of patients), digestive (76%), pain and discomfort (76%), energy-related (71%), and sensory (62%). Patients identified a sensation as a treatment side effect if they had not experienced it before, if there was a temporal link between the sensation and receipt of treatment, and/or if their doctors consistently told or asked them about it in relation to side effects. Themes that emerged when patients talked about their cancer treatment and its side effects related to the serious nature of their advanced disease and their treatment expectations. Patients focused on treatment benefits, wanting a better quality of life, being hopeful, not really having a choice, and not thinking about side effects. Conclusions In these two qualitative sub-studies, patients with advanced NSCLC valued the benefits of their treatment regardless of side effects that they experienced. Patients weighed their options against the seriousness of their disease and expressed their willingness to tolerate their side effects in return for receiving continued treatment benefits.

BackgroundEffective options are limited for patients with non–small-cell lung cancer (NSCLC) whose disease progresses after first-line chemotherapy. Camrelizumab is a potent anti-PD-1 monoclonal antibody and has shown promising activity in NSCLC. We assessed the activity and safety of camrelizumab for patients with previously treated, advanced NSCLC patients with negative oncogenic drivers.MethodsPatients who progressed during or following platinum-based doublet chemotherapy were enrolled. All patients received camrelizumab(200 mg)every 3 weeks or in combination with chemotherapy until loss of clinical benefit. The primary endpoint was objective response rate (ORR), other endpoints included disease control rate (DCR), progression-free survival (PFS) and safety.ResultsBetween Aug 5, 2019, and Jun 19, 2020, we enrolled 29 patients, 25 patients were available evaluated, ORR and DCR was 36% (9/25) and 92% (23/25), respectively. 25 of 29 patients were still receiving the treatment, the median PFS was not yet achieved. Compared with those without reactive cutaneous capillary endothelial proliferation (RCCEP), patients with RCCEP had higher ORR (60% vs. 28.6%). Treatment-related adverse events (AEs) occurred in 69.0% of patients (all Grade), and the most common were RCCEP (37.9%), pneumonitis (6.9%), and chest congestion (6.9%). Treatment-related grade 3 to 4 adverse events occurred in 10.3% of patients.ConclusionsIn patients with previously treated advanced NSCLC, camrelizumab demonstrated improved ORR and DCR, compared with historical data of the 2nd line chemotherapy, with a manageable safety profile. While patients with RCCEP derived greater benefit from camrelizumab. Further studies are needed in large sample size trials.

PurposeSorafenib is an oral multikinase inhibitor that targets the Ras/Raf/MEK/ERK mitogenic signaling pathway and the angiogenic receptor tyrosine kinases, vascular endothelial growth factor receptor 2 and platelet-derived growth factor receptor β. We evaluated the antitumor response and tolerability of sorafenib in patients with relapsed or refractory, advanced non–small-cell lung cancer (NSCLC), most of whom had received prior platinum-based chemotherapy.Patients and MethodsThis was a phase II, single-arm, multicenter study. Patients with relapsed or refractory advanced NSCLC received sorafenib 400 mg orally twice daily until tumor progression or an unacceptable drug-related toxicity occurred. The primary objective was to measure response rate.ResultsOf 54 patients enrolled, 52 received sorafenib. The predominant histologies were adenocarcinoma (54%) and squamous cell carcinoma (31%). No complete or partial responses were observed. Stable disease (SD) was achieved in 30 (59%) of the 51 patients who were evaluable for efficacy. Four patients with SD developed tumor cavitation. Median progression-free survival (PFS) was 2.7 months, and median overall survival was 6.7 months. Patients with SD had a median PFS of 5.5 months. Major grades 3 to 4, treatment-related toxicities included hand-foot skin reaction (10%), hypertension (4%), fatigue (2%), and diarrhea (2%). Nine patients died within a 30-day period after discontinuing sorafenib, and one patient experienced pulmonary hemorrhage that was considered drug related.ConclusionContinuous treatment with sorafenib 400 mg twice daily was associated with disease stabilization in patients with advanced NSCLC. The broad activity of sorafenib and its acceptable toxicity profile suggest that additional investigation of sorafenib as therapy for patients with NSCLC is warranted.

Purpose To compare efficacy of pemetrexed versus pemetrexed plus carboplatin in pretreated patients with advanced non–small-cell lung cancer (NSCLC). Patients and Methods Patients with advanced NSCLC, in progression during or after first-line platinum-based chemotherapy, were randomly assigned to receive pemetrexed (arm A) or pemetrexed plus carboplatin (arm B). Primary end point was progression-free survival (PFS). A preplanned pooled analysis of the results of this study with those of the NVALT7 study was carried out to assess the impact of carboplatin added to pemetrexed in terms of overall survival (OS). Results From July 2007 to October 2009, 239 patients (arm A, n = 120; arm B, n = 119) were enrolled. Median PFS was 3.6 months for arm A versus 3.5 months for arm B (hazard ratio [HR], 1.05; 95% CI, 0.81 to 1.36; P = .706). No statistically significant differences in response rate, OS, or toxicity were observed. A total of 479 patients were included in the pooled analysis. OS was not improved by the addition of carboplatin to pemetrexed (HR, 90; 95% CI, 0.74 to 1.10; P = .316; P heterogeneity = .495). In the subgroup analyses, the addition of carboplatin to pemetrexed in patients with squamous tumors led to a statistically significant improvement in OS from 5.4 to 9 months (adjusted HR, 0.58; 95% CI, 0.37 to 0.91; P interaction test = .039). Conclusion Second-line treatment of advanced NSCLC with pemetrexed plus carboplatin does not improve survival outcomes as compared with single-agent pemetrexed. The benefit observed with carboplatin addition in squamous tumors may warrant further investigation.

For patients with advanced non-small-cell lung cancer (nsclc) lacking a targetable molecular driver, the mainstay of treatment has been cytotoxic chemotherapy. The survival benefit of chemotherapy in this setting is modest and comes with the potential for significant toxicity. The introduction of immunotherapeutic agents targeting the programmed cell death 1 protein (PD-1) and the programmed cell death ligand 1 (PD-L1) has drastically changed the treatment paradigms for these patients. Three agents—atezolizumab, nivolumab, and pembrolizumab—have been shown to be superior to chemotherapy in the second-line setting. For patients with tumours strongly expressing PD-L1, pembrolizumab has been associated with improved outcomes in the first-line setting.Demonstration of the significant benefits of immunotherapy in nsclc has focused attention on new questions. Combination checkpoint regimens, with acceptable toxicity and potentially enhanced efficacy, have been developed, as have combinations of immunotherapy with chemotherapy. In this review, we focus on the published trials that have changed the treatment landscape in advanced nsclc and on the ongoing clinical trials that offer hope to further improve outcomes for patients with advanced nsclc.

Background Advanced non-small-cell lung cancer (nsclc) represents a major health issue globally. Systemic treatment decisions are informed by clinical trials, which, over years, have improved the survival of patients with advanced nsclc. The applicability of clinical trial results to the broad lung cancer population is unclear because strict eligibility criteria in trials generally select for optimal patients.Methods We performed a retrospective chart review of all consecutive patients with advanced nsclc seen in outpatient consultation at our academic institution between September 2009 and September 2012, collecting data about patient demographics and cancer characteristics, treatment, and survival from hospital and pharmacy records. Two sets of arbitrary trial eligibility criteria were applied to the cohort. Scenario A stipulated Eastern Cooperative Oncology Group performance status (ecog ps) 0–1, no brain metastasis, creatinine less than 120 μmol/L, and no second malignancy. Less-strict scenario B stipulated ecog ps 0–2 and creatinine less than 120 μmol/L. We then used the two scenarios to analyze treatment and survival of patients by trial eligibility status.Results The 528 included patients had a median age of 67 years, with 55% being men and 58% having adenocarcinoma. Of those 528 patients, 291 received at least 1 line of palliative systemic therapy. Using the scenario A eligibility criteria, 73% were trial-ineligible. However, 46% of “ineligible” patients actually received therapy and experienced survival similar to that of the “eligible” treated patients (10.2 months vs. 11.6 months, p = 0.10). Using the scenario B criteria, only 35% were ineligible, but again, the survival of treated patients was similar in the ineligible and eligible groups (10.1 months vs. 10.9 months, p = 0.57).Conclusions Current trial eligibility criteria are often strict and limit the enrolment of patients in clinical trials. Our results suggest that, depending on the chosen drug, its toxicities and tolerability, eligibility criteria could be carefully reviewed and relaxed.

Abstract Backgrounds: Astrocyte-elevated gene-1 (AEG-1) functions as an oncogene and regulates angiogenesis in non-small cell lung cancer (NSCLC). In this prospective study, we assessed the values of plasma AEG-1 mRNA expression by liquid biopsy associated with tumor response and survival in NSCLC patients treated with pemetrexed. Methods: Patients diagnosed advanced NSCLC were enrolled to be treated with pemetrexed combined platinum as first-line chemotherapy. All patients underwent blood sampling before any cancer treatment (C0) and at first response evaluation after two cycles (C2) treatments. Response to chemotherapy and survival were assessed. Plasma mRNA was extracted from peripheral blood mononuclear cell (PBMC) and quantification of RNA was performed by real-time PCR.Results: A total of 50 patients with advanced NSCLC were included and 13 of 50 patients combined with bevacizumab. In patient groups of SD (n = 13) and PD (n = 10), the plasma mRNA of AEG-1, thymidylate synthase (TS) and CK19 were elevated significantly at C2 compared to patients in treatment response group (PR, n = 27) (PR v.s. SD or PD, AEG-1: 1.22 ± 0.80 v.s. 4.51 ± 15.45, p = 0.043). NSCLC patients had elevated AEG-1 (AEG-1 ≥ 2) after 2-cycle chemotherapy had shorter PFS and OS (high AEG-1 v.s. low AEG-1, median, PFS: 5.5 v.s. 11.9 months, p = 0.021; OS: 25.9 v.s. 40.8 months, p = 0.019, respectively). In Cox regression analysis, increased plasma mRNA expression of AEG-1indicated poor prognosis in survival.Conclusion: Circulating mRNA concentration of AEG-1 could be a predictive and prognostic biomarker in NSCLC patients treated with pemetrexed. Increased expression of AEG-1 contributed to the chemoresistance and caused lung cancer progression.

Over the last decade, several steps forward in the treatment of patients with stage IV non-small cell lung cancer (NCSLC) were made. Examples are the use of pemetrexed, pemetrexed maintenance therapy, or bevacizumab for patients with nonsquamous NSCLC. A big leap forward was the use of tyrosine kinase inhibitors in patients selected on the basis of an activating oncogene, such as epidermal growth factor receptor ( EGFR) activating mutations or anaplastic lymphoma kinase ( ALK) translocations. However, all of these achievements could not be translated into survival benefits when studied in randomized controlled trials in patients with nonmetastatic NSCLC. Aside from chemotherapy and targeted therapy, immunotherapy has become the third pillar in the treatment armamentarium of advanced NSCLC. Antigen-specific immunotherapy (cancer vaccination) has been disappointing in large phase III clinical trials in stages I–III NSCLC. Based on the recent breakthroughs with immune checkpoint inhibitor immunotherapy in metastatic NSCLC, much hope currently rests on the use of this approach in patients with stage I–III NSCLC as well. Here we give a brief overview of how most new therapeutic approaches for advanced NSCLC failed in other stages, and then elaborate on the role of immunotherapy in patients with stage I–III NSCLC.

This is a summary of a research study (known as a clinical trial) called CROWN. The study tested two medicines called lorlatinib and crizotinib in participants with untreated non-small cell lung cancer that had spread to other parts of their body. All those who took part had changes in a gene called ALK, which is involved in cell growth. In total, 296 participants from 23 countries took part. Half the participants took lorlatinib and half took crizotinib. After participants started taking lorlatinib or crizotinib, they were checked regularly to see if their tumors had grown or spread to other parts of their body (known as tumor progression) and to monitor any side effects. After 1 year of treatment, the participants who took lorlatinib were twice as likely to be alive with no tumor growth as the participants who took crizotinib. More participants who took lorlatinib had cancer that shrank (76%) compared with the participants who took crizotinib (58%). This was also true of the participants whose cancer had spread to their brain. The most common side effects in participants who took lorlatinib were increases in the amount of cholesterol and triglycerides (a type of fat) in their blood, swelling, weight gain, nerve damage, unclear thoughts, and diarrhea. Among the participants who took crizotinib, the most common side effects were diarrhea, feeling like you want to throw up, sight problems, swelling, vomiting, changes in liver function, and feeling tired. Overall, the CROWN study showed that fewer participants with advanced ALK+ non-small cell lung cancer died or had tumor growth with lorlatinib compared with crizotinib treatment. Abstract PurposeProgrammed cell death-1 (PD-1)/programmed death-ligand 1 (PD-L1) inhibitors plus chemotherapy has become the standard first-line treatment in patients with advanced non-small-cell lung cancer (NSCLC). However, few studies have explicitly focused on the impact of cancer cachexia on the efficacy of PD-1/PD-L1 inhibitors plus chemotherapy. Thus, we evaluated the clinical implications of cancer cachexia on the survival outcomes in patients who received this treatment.MethodsWe conducted a retrospective review of medical records of patients with advanced NSCLC treated with PD-1/PD-L1 inhibitors plus chemotherapy from December 2018 to December 2020. Cancer cachexia was diagnosed as an unintentional weight loss of 5% or more over six months. We evaluated the progression-free survival (PFS) and overall survival (OS) for patients with or without cancer cachexia who received PD-1/PD-L1 inhibitors plus chemotherapy.ResultsAmong the 80 included patients, 37 (46%) had cancer cachexia. Cachectic patients had a lower objective response rate (30 vs 51%, P <0.05), poorer PFS (2.3 vs 12.0 months, P <0.05), and poorer OS (10.8 vs 23.9 months, P <0.05) than non-cachectic patients. The Cox proportional-hazard ratios (95% confidence interval) of cancer cachexia were 1.77 (1.01–3.10) for PFS and 2.90 (1.40–6.00) for OS, with adjustments for Eastern Cooperative Oncology Group performance status, PD-L1 tumour proportion score, histology, and central nervous system metastases. ConclusionPre-treatment cancer cachexia may reduce treatment efficacy and shorten survival time in patients receiving PD-1/PD-L1 inhibitors plus chemotherapy. Early evaluation and intervention for cancer cachexia might improve oncological outcomes in patients with advanced NSCLC.
